Group 1: Core Perspectives - The 12th Fortune Forum focuses on "Re-evaluating, Reconstructing, and Reigniting - The Leap in Asset Value Driven by AI" and gathers top experts to discuss global order changes, AI industry trends, asset allocation directions, and investment opportunities [1] - The forum features a roundtable discussion on the dual impact of geopolitical tensions and the AI technology revolution, clarifying the core logic for investors amidst changing macroeconomic conditions [1][2] - Experts emphasize that despite external disturbances, Chinese assets exhibit significant allocation value due to policy support, manufacturing resilience, and technological breakthroughs [3] Group 2: Investment Themes - Assets are categorized into three types: strong cyclical (real estate chain), stable (gold, high dividends), and tech emerging (AI, innovative pharmaceuticals), with gold seen as a hedge against weakening dollar credit [2] - The focus on AI applications and service consumption is highlighted as a dual upgrade opportunity, with a particular interest in the downstream applications of AI [3] - The importance of internationalization for external demand enterprises and the need for domestic enterprises to focus on rigid demand and innovation upgrades are discussed [4] Group 3: Sector Insights - The resilience of China's manufacturing sector is emphasized, with companies needing to shift from "manufacturing overseas" to "branding overseas" to enhance value [4] - The AI hardware capital expenditure is still in a deep water zone, indicating that China has broader space for AI applications in the long term [5] - Innovative pharmaceutical companies are seen as capable of withstanding decoupling risks through talent and technological barriers, with global authorization partnerships being key to market expansion [6]
